Abstract

The invention discloses a complex microbial inoculant for tobacco as well as a production device and a production method of the complex microbial inoculant. The complex microbial inoculant comprises the following materials: 2 parts of bacillus amyloliquefaciens, 2 parts of bacillus mucilaginosus, 4 parts of bacillus megatherium and 2 parts of d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ria. A liquid seed culture medium (g / L): 10 g of NaCl, 10 g of peptone and 10 g of yeast powder; the fermentation medium (g / L) comprises 50 g of corn starch, 70 g of soybean meal, 3 g of peptone, 1 g of monopotassium phosphate, 0.5 g of magnesium sulfate, 0.2 g of ferrous sulfate, 0.02 g of manganese sulfate and 5 g of light calcium carbonate; bacillus amyloliquefaciens, bacillus megaterium, bacillus mucilaginosus and d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ria are selected to prepare the multifunctional composite microbial agent, and the prepared composite microbial agent has multiple functions of antagonizing pathogenic bacteria, promoting nutrient absorption, degrading allelopathic autotoxic substances and the like. The multifunctional complex microbial inoculant and a macromolecular bioactive substance polyglutamic acid are synergistically applied, so that the activity of the strain is enhanced, and a synergistic interaction effect is achieved.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of tobacco planting, in particular to a compound microbial agent for tobacco and a production device and method thereof. BACKGROUND

[0002] Due to the limitations of factors such as arable land resources, planting conditions and production costs, the current tobacco planting mode often adopts the mode of perennial continuous cropping, and the phenomenon of unreasonable application of chemical fertilizers is also common, which causes the deterioration of tobacco planting soil, the imbalance of beneficial functional flora, the aggravation of disease and pest damage, the hindering of tobacco growth and development, and further affects the yield of tobacco, especially the improvement of tobacco quality.

[0003] At present, in the agricultural production of tobacco, beneficial microorganisms play an important role in promoting the growth and development of tobacco and preventing diseases, and certain practical applications have been achieved, but the common microbial agents often have insufficient composition and function, and the strain adaptability is not strong, which is difficult to achieve the ideal effect of tobacco disease resistance and growth promotion. Especially for the phenomenon of long-term continuous cropping of tobacco, a large amount of allelopathic autotoxic substances will accumulate in the tobacco planting soil, which seriously restricts the growth and development level of tobacco itself. SUMMARY

[0004] The purpose of the present application is to provide a compound microbial agent for tobacco and a production device and method thereof to solve the problems raised in the background.

[0005] To achieve the above purpose, the present application provides the following technical scheme: a compound microbial agent for tobacco, comprising the following materials: 2 parts of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, 2 parts of Bacillus mucilaginosus, 4 parts of Bacillus megaterium and 2 parts of d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ria; Liquid seed culture medium (g / L): NaCl 10, peptone 10 and yeast powder 10; Fermentation medium (g / L): corn starch 50, soybean meal 70, peptone 3, potassium dihydrogen phosphate 1, magnesium sulfate 0.5, ferrous sulfate 0.2, manganese sulfate 0.02 and light calcium 5.

[0014] A fermentation preparation method of a composite microbial agent for tobacco: S1: Four kinds of fermentation bacteria seed liquid preparation: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, Bacillus mucilaginosus, Bacillus megaterium and d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ria are respectively activated by using eggplant bottle solid culture medium, and are respectively transferred to 50mL liquid seed culture medium, and are cultured at 37℃ by using a shaking bed at 230rpm, and after 12h, the above four liquid seed liquids are respectively secondarily inoculated into 250mL liquid seed culture medium at a inoculation ratio of 2%, and are cultured at 37℃ by using a shaking bed at 230rpm for 12h.

[0015] S2: Fermenter treatment: clean and empty the internal fermenter for sterilization, configure the fermentation medium according to 50% liquid volume, and add the medium into the interior of the fermenter through the liquid injection pipe, and again implement empty sterilization, then add the seed liquid of four fermentation strains of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, Bacillus mucilaginosus, Bacillus megaterium and d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ria into the interior of the fermenter through the additive pipe in sequence.

[0016] S3: Preparation of solid multifunctional composite microbial agent: the four fermentation strain seed liquids are inoculated in the ratio of Bacillus amyloliquefaciens: Bacillus mucilaginosus: Bacillus megaterium: d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ria 2:2:4:2, the inoculation amount is 3%, after 36h fermentation, multifunctional composite microbial fermentation liquid is obtained, then the electromagnetic valve is controlled to open, the multifunctional composite microbial fermentation liquid is discharged into the container through the liquid outlet pipe, and the multifunctional composite microbial fermentation liquid is subjected to spray drying treatment to obtain a solid multifunctional composite microbial agent.

[0017]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of the present application are: by selecting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, Bacillus megaterium, Bacillus mucilaginosus and d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ria, the multifunctional composite microbial agent prepared by the multifunctional composite microbial agent has the functions of pathogenic bacteria antagonism, nutrient absorption promotion and degradation of allelopathic and autotoxic substances, etc., and when applied in tobacco fields, the multifunctional composite microbial agent is synergistically applied with macromolecular bioactive substance polyglutamic acid, which is a water-soluble, biodegradable, non-toxic biological macromolecule prepared by microbial fermentation method, can provide a carrier for the growth of functional strains, enhance the activity of the strains, and achieve a synergistic effect. In addition, the main stirring assembly and the auxiliary stirring assembly synergistically stir, the material mixing coefficient in the fermenter can be increased to more than 0.9, effectively avoiding the problems of too high or too low local concentration of the strains, ensuring uniform distribution of the number of strains in each milliliter of fermentation liquid, providing a stable environment for the metabolic synergy of the four strains, the carbohydrates decomposed by Bacillus amyloliquefaciens can provide carbon source for other strains, the sticky substances secreted by Bacillus mucilaginosus can enhance the cohesiveness between strains, and the stress-resistant environment created by Bacillus megaterium can enhance the activity of the target degrading bacteria, finally the degradation rate of dibutyl phthalate is increased by 20%-30%, and the fermentation period is shortened by 15%-20%, significantly improving the fermentation efficiency and functional effect. DETAILED DESCRIPTION

[0026] Please refer to Figures 1-6The application provides a technical scheme: a composite microbial inoculant for tobacco, which comprises the following materials: 2 parts of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, 2 parts of Bacillus mucilaginosus, 4 parts of Bacillus megaterium and 2 parts of d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ria, the composite microbial inoculant needs to simultaneously realize antagonism against pathogenic bacteria, promote nutrient absorption and degrade dibutyl phthalate, the d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ria directly acts on dibutyl phthalate accumulated in soil, eliminates the inhibition of dibutyl phthalate on tobacco root growth and relieves continuous cropping obstacles, which is a key link of multifunctionality of the composite microbial inoculant, the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, the Bacillus mucilaginosus and the Bacillus megaterium mainly undertake the functions of secreting plant hormones and inhibiting bacteria, and the d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ria can improve the colonization efficiency of other bacteria by removing dibutyl phthalate, so that the inhibition of self-toxic substances on the activity of functional bacteria is avoided, the species of the d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ria mainly include Pseudomonas, Bacillus and Acinetobacter, the characteristics of strains between different species have certain differences, in actual production, the d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ria can be selected according to the actual use and demand of the composite microbial inoculant, when the specific d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ria is selected, the specific d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ria can be determined according to the actual application scene and environmental conditions, if efficient degradation of dibutyl phthalate is needed and the environmental conditions are suitable, Pseudomonas can be selected; if degradation under various environmental conditions is needed, Bacillus can be selected; in addition, according to environmental adaptability and safety, when the microbial inoculant is used for tobacco soil, Bacillus is preferentially selected as the d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ria, the Bacillus has the characteristics of high temperature resistance and acid and alkali resistance, has strong compatibility with the survival conditions of other Bacillus in the composite microbial inoculant and meets the safety standards of agricultural microbial inoculants; The liquid seed culture medium is NaCl 10 g / L, protein peptone 10 g / L and yeast powder 10 g / L, and the liquid seed culture medium provides nutrients required by the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, the Bacillus mucilaginosus, the Bacillus megaterium and the d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ria during culture, so that the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, the Bacillus mucilaginosus, the Bacillus megaterium and the d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ria generate corresponding liquid seed solutions; The fermentation culture medium is corn starch 50 g / L, soybean meal 70 g / L, protein peptone 3 g / L, potassium dihydrogen phosphate 1 g / L, magnesium sulfate 0.5 g / L, ferrous sulfate 0.2 g / L, manganese sulfate 0.02 g / L and light calcium 5 g / L, and the fermentation culture medium provides nutrients required by the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, the Bacillus mucilaginosus, the Bacillus megaterium and the d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ria during fermentation, so that the fermentation effect of the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, the Bacillus mucilaginosus, the Bacillus megaterium and the dibutyl phthalate-degrading bacteria is ensured, thereby ensuring that the multifunctional composite microbial fermentation liquid can be stably generated.

[0028] The culture medium can be added to the inside of the fermentation tank 1 through the liquid injection pipe 4. During the liquid injection process, the volume of the culture medium needs to be monitored in real time through the liquid level sensor installed inside the fermentation tank 1 to ensure that it reaches the preset fermentation level, which is usually 60%-70% of the tank capacity, to avoid material overflow during subsequent stirring due to too high liquid level, or to avoid affecting the metabolic environment of the strain due to too low liquid level. After the liquid injection is completed, the valve outside the liquid injection pipe 4 is closed and the liquid injection pipe 4 is cleaned in situ to prevent residual culture medium from breeding bacteria. Then the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, Bacillus mucilaginosus, Bacillus megaterium and d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ria seed liquids are added to the inside of the fermentation tank 1 through the additive pipe 5 in turn. The Bacillus amyloliquefaciens seed liquid is injected first because it has strong carbohydrate decomposition ability and can provide basic metabolic products for the system in advance. After standing for 10 minutes, the Bacillus mucilaginosus seed liquid is injected. This bacterium can secrete sticky substances and needs to be preliminarily mixed with the former to avoid local agglomeration. After standing for another 15 minutes, the Bacillus megaterium seed liquid is injected. This bacterium has strong stress resistance and can quickly colonize in the mixed system. Finally, the d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ria seed liquid is injected. As the target functional bacteria, it needs to achieve efficient degradation in the metabolic environment constructed by other bacteria. During the addition process, the positive pressure state in the additive pipe 5 needs to be maintained, and the pressure is controlled at 0.2-0.3MPa. After the addition is completed, an external sterile filter is added inside the additive pipe 5 for filtration to prevent external bacteria from being contaminated. Then the driving motor 3 is started. The output end of the driving motor 3 can drive the main stirring rod 21 to rotate, thereby driving the main stirring blade 19, the connecting rod 12 and the arc-shaped stirring rod 14 to rotate, realizing stirring of the material in the inside of the fermentation tank 1, thereby fully rotating and stirring the fermentation medium and the seed liquids of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, Bacillus mucilaginosus, Bacillus megaterium and d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ria in the inside of the fermentation tank 1, thereby ensuring the fermentation effect and improving the fermentation efficiency. In addition, when the main stirring rod 21 rotates, it can drive the connecting strip 23 to rotate, and in cooperation with the internal tooth ring 13, it can make the gear 20 rotate, thereby making the fixed column 26 rotate, thereby making the main stirring rod 21 move, pushing the auxiliary stirring rod 16 to move, making the sliding block 28 move in the inside of the sliding slot frame 27, thereby making the auxiliary stirring rod 16 reciprocate along the connecting strip 23, thereby making the auxiliary stirring strip 18 and the auxiliary stirring frame 17 reciprocate, fully horizontally stirring and mixing the fermentation medium and the seed liquids of Bacillus amyloliquefaciens, Bacillus mucilaginosus, Bacillus megaterium and dibutyl phthalate degrading bacteria in the inside of the fermentation tank 1, thereby improving the stirring and mixing efficiency and being helpful for better fermentation and improving the fermentation effect. The auxiliary stirring strip 18 is in the shape of a rhombus net frame and can disperse large-volume material groups into small particles, thereby further improving the mixing uniformity. Through the stirring synergy of the main stirring assembly and the auxiliary stirring, the material mixing coefficient in the fermentation tank 1 can be improved to 0.9 The above effectively avoids the problem of excessive or insufficient local concentration of bacteria, ensuring uniform distribution of bacteria in each milliliter of fermentation broth, providing a stable environment for the metabolic synergy of the four bacteria, and the carbohydrates decomposed by Bacillus amyloliquefaciens can provide carbon sources for other bacteria, the sticky substances secreted by Bacillus mucilaginosus can enhance the cohesiveness between bacteria, and the stress-resistant environment created by Bacillus megaterium can enhance the activity of the target degrading bacteria, ultimately increasing the degradation rate of dibutyl phthalate by 20%-30%, while shortening the fermentation period by 15%-20%, significantly improving the fermentation efficiency and functional effect.
